The backend of a gist server written in Rust
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
Dylan Baker 40f4b62c68 Add links to binaries to homepage 11 months ago
migrations Use sha hashes instead of primary key 11 months ago
src Decode raw snippets to avoid > etc 11 months ago
static Add links to binaries to homepage 11 months ago
templates Add links to binaries to homepage 11 months ago
.gitignore Initial commit 11 months ago
.rsyncignore Add rsyncignore 11 months ago
Cargo.lock Use sha hashes instead of primary key 11 months ago
Cargo.toml Use separate stylesheet, clean up styles 11 months ago
LICENSE Add license and readme 11 months ago
Procfile Set in Procfile 11 months ago
README.md Add license and readme 11 months ago
RustConfig Update rust config 11 months ago
diesel.toml Initial commit 11 months ago
rust-toolchain Heroku config 11 months ago

README.md

bngl.ws server

This is the server component of the bngl.ws pastebin service.

Running the server

With cargo and diesel installed:

$ git clone https://git.sr.ht/~simulacrumparty/bnglws-server
$ cd bnglws-server
$ echo 'DATABASE_URL=postgres://username@host/dbname' > .env;
$ diesel database setup
$ cargo run